Highlights

We are a traditional Texas BBQ joint right in the heart of downtown Las Vegas. We use old school low and slow cooking techniques with real hardwood pit cooker. Brisket, ribs, sausage and poultry are offered as well as southern and Mexican side dishes.

"In the Arts District, Braeswood BBQ brings Tex Mex barbecue with a food truck that pops up until the restaurant opens in the Arts District this fall. Lately, the food truck parks at Beer District Brewing in the Arts District or Bad Beat Brewing in Henderson until it can open at 1504 S. Main St., next to the upcoming Western-themed speakeasy, the Horse Trailer Hideout, and the neighborhood’s first planned sports tavern. Options include baby back ribs, brisket tacos, spare ribs, a smokehouse burger, and sides such as cornbread and mac and cheese. Shrimp and grits, a fajita, and aqua fresca and sweet tea round out the menu." - Susan Stapleton
